CeNTAB--Infrastructure

The Centre for Nanotechnology & Advanced Biomaterials (CeNTAB) at SASTRA University is well equipped with state-of-the-art equipment for characterization of structural, optical, mechanical, thermal and electrical properties of nanomaterials. These high-end equipment provide ample skill set and hands-on training to students aspiring for a career in nanotechnology. SASTRA is ranked among the best private Universities in India in terms of infrastructure and expertise.

 


CeNTAB has nine research laboratories to carry out cutting-edge research in the field of medical nanotechnology. These include facilities for SEM imaging, Polymer synthesis, Fluorescent imaging, Animal cell culture, instrumental analysis, nanomaterials synthesis, electrophysiology, nanofluids development, mesoporous material synthesis, thin film deposition and nanosensor evaluation.

Equipment at CeNTAB


CeNTAB is equipped with the following:

•  Field emission scanning electron microscope (FE-SEM)
•  Energy Dispersive X-ray Analyzer (EDX)
•  X-ray Diffractometer (XRD)
•  Atomic Force Microscope (AFM)
•  Confocal Microscope
•  Particle Size Anlyzer (PSA)
•  Fourier Transform Infrared Spectroscope (FTIR)
•  Spectrofluorimeter
•  UV-Visible Spectrophotometer
•  Contact Angle Analyser
•  High Pressure Liquid Chromatograph
•  Mercury Porosimeter
•  Differential Scanning Calorimeter (DSC)
•  Uniaxial Testing Machine (UTM)
•  Rotary Evaporator
•  Lyophilizer
•  CO2 incubator
•  Real time RT-PCR
•  Electrochemical Workstation
•  Electrometer
•  LCZ meter
•  Shear Homogenizer
•  Bead mill
•  Spray pyrolysis
•  Gas / chemical evaluation system
•  Electrospinning Unit
•  Inverted microscope
•  Multimode reader (to be installed)
